How you will contribute:

  • The Rare Disease Business Manager will achieve sales quotas through driving new patient starts, sales in outpatient infusion centers and hospitals, and retention of patients on Takeda augmentation treatment.
  • These efforts occur through a focus on healthcare professionals (Pulmonology, Allergy/Immunology, Respiratory Therapists, select Internal Medicine/Primary Care). Educate and inform the HCPs on Takeda brands for Alpha-1 Antitrypsin Deficiency. You will build the National Sales and Marketing Strategy in a compliant manner while creating a territory business tactical plan to maximize opportunity.
  • The Rare Disease Business Manager, Alpha-1, will manage the business within a specific geographical territory.
  • Calls on prospective customers, masters sales presentations, provides technical and administrative product information and demonstrations, and maintains compliance to our promotional and expense policies.
  • The RDBM, Alpha-1 will report directly to a Sr. Regional Business Director.
  • You will work in partnership with home office personnel, the Marketing/Brand team, and the National and Corporate account teams for pull-through of product sales.
  • RDBM Alpha-1 will use Microsoft applications and Takeda's customer management system.
  • Conduct community education events for healthcare professionals, patients, and can work occasional nights and weekends.
  • Promote the Takeda Culture through positive ongoing relationships and activities.
